The following table compares key facts for each schools including acceptance rate, graduation rate, tuition, student to faculty ratio, and student population.
Name | Tuition & Fees | Acceptance Rate | Graduation Rate | Student Faculty Ratio | Student Population |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Cincinnati State Technical and Community College | $5,400 / $9,801 | - | 16% | 12:1 | 8,404 |
Clark State College | $4,200 / $7,809 | - | 31% | 13:1 | 4,703 |
Kent State University at Trumbull | $7,272 / $16,744 | - | 12% | 25:1 | 1,734 |
Ohio State University-Main Campus | $12,859 / $38,365 | 52.72% | 88% | 17:1 | 60,540 |
Shawnee State University | $9,622 / $16,157 | - | 35% | 14:1 | 3,297 |
University of Toledo | $12,377 / $21,737 | 92.23% | 54% | 17:1 | 15,545 |
